Ruso continues his contract as a medic with the 20th legion, this time up on the northern border. Between wild barbarians, jumpy centurions, and his shady housekeeper, he gets dragged again into solving murders.

The second in Downie's Medicus series this story sees Ruso and Tilla heading north to the "frontier." I didn't like this one as much as the first. I think because the protagonist ends up jumping to ideas that seem a bit shaky. Still, I will probably read the next one before making final judgement on the series... ...more
